Idiopathic normal pressure hydrocephalus (INPH) is characterized by gait impairment, cognitive decline and urinary incontinence, and is associated with ventricular enlargement in the absence of elevated cerebrospinal fluid pressure. This review describes the diagnosis and treatment of INPH, with particular reference to the recently published INPH consensus guidelines.
